首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Laravel 7.14显示购物车中未提供给用户的产品

Laravel 7.14是一个流行的PHP开发框架,用于构建Web应用程序。它提供了丰富的功能和工具,使开发人员能够快速构建高质量的应用程序。

购物车是一个常见的电子商务功能,用于存储用户选择的商品并进行结算。在Laravel中,可以使用Session来实现购物车功能。购物车中未提供给用户的产品可能是指在购物车中存在但用户尚未看到或选择的产品。

购物车中未提供给用户的产品可能有以下几种情况:

  1. 预购产品:某些产品可能尚未正式发布或供用户购买,但可以添加到购物车中进行预订或预购。这种情况下,购物车中的产品可以作为用户的待购清单。
  2. 限时优惠产品:某些产品可能只在特定时间段内提供优惠价格或特殊促销活动。这些产品可以添加到购物车中,但用户只能在特定时间内享受优惠。
  3. 隐藏产品:某些产品可能是特定用户或特定条件下可见的,例如VIP会员专属产品或特定地区的产品。这些产品可以添加到购物车中,但只有符合条件的用户才能看到并购买。

对于以上情况,可以通过以下方式在Laravel中实现购物车中未提供给用户的产品:

  1. 在购物车中添加预购产品的功能,包括产品的预订和预购日期等信息。可以使用Laravel的Session或数据库来存储购物车数据。
  2. 在购物车中添加限时优惠产品的功能,包括产品的促销价格和促销时间等信息。可以使用Laravel的Session或数据库来存储购物车数据,并在结算时根据促销时间计算价格。
  3. 在购物车中添加隐藏产品的功能,包括产品的可见条件和用户身份验证等信息。可以使用Laravel的Session或数据库来存储购物车数据,并在展示购物车内容时根据条件过滤产品。

对于实现购物车功能,腾讯云提供了一系列适用的产品和服务:

  1. 云服务器(CVM):用于托管和运行Web应用程序的虚拟服务器实例。可以使用腾讯云的云服务器来部署和运行Laravel应用程序。
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务。可以使用腾讯云的云数据库MySQL版来存储购物车数据和产品信息。
  3. 云存储(COS):提供安全、可靠的对象存储服务。可以使用腾讯云的云存储来存储产品图片和其他静态资源。
  4. 云函数(SCF):无服务器计算服务,用于处理购物车中的业务逻辑。可以使用腾讯云的云函数来实现购物车中产品的添加、删除和结算等功能。
  5. 人工智能服务(AI):腾讯云提供了多种人工智能服务,如图像识别、语音识别等。可以使用这些服务来增强购物车功能,如自动识别产品图片、语音搜索等。

以上是关于Laravel 7.14显示购物车中未提供给用户的产品的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【畅购商城】购物车模块之查看购物车

目录 分析 接口 后端实现 前端实现:显示页面 前端实现:显示购物车信息 分析 用户如果没有登录,购物车存放在浏览器端localStorage处,且以数组方式进行存储。...用户如果登录了,购物车存放在redis,以Cart对象字符串方式存储。...步骤二:修改CartController,添加queryCartList 方法,仅返回购物车数据 步骤一:修改CartService,添加 queryCartList 方法, /** * *...如果没有创建一个 return JSON.parseObject(cartString, Cart.class); } 步骤三:修改CartController,添加queryCartList 方法,仅返回购物车数据...$request.getCart()       this.cart = data.data     } else {       //登录:从浏览器本地获得购物车       let cartStr

1.2K20

猿设计19——真电商之你所不知道购物车

如果你初次进入购物车或者刷新购物车购物车商品信息、促销信息都需同步更新。至于选中功能怎么处理?...需要合并购物车 大家都知道,购物车,是可以在登录状态下,提供给用户使用。那么带来一个新问题——用户如果在登录状态下,加购了商品,然后又重新登录了购物车,怎么去展示最终结果?。...促销信息 相信你已经看见上图中内容了,购物车中会显示促销相关信息,比如满减、满赠、赠品,优惠券等信息。注意“促销”两个字还有箭头噢,点开之后,可以选择使用具体优惠项。...同时如果用户选择了不同优惠,也需要将优惠金额计算进去,在购物车未将优惠券优惠金额算入,主要是促销和优惠券是两个体系,优惠券使用,是用户可根据需要在结算页面自由选择符合要求优惠券使用。...购物车需求和功能点我们一起来画一下吧。 ? 以上就是购物车需求和功能挖掘,在接下来一章,我们一起来分析具体业务逻辑,完成对应设计。

80110

Pixer v6.5.0 – React Laravel 电子商务多供应商数字市场

简介 Pixer – React Laravel Multivendor 是一个基于 Laravel、React、Next JS 和 Tailwind CSS 实现数字电子商务市场脚本。...在前端,我们使用了 React、NextJS [TypeScript] 和 Tailwind,以及后端 Laravel。完整源代码可用。它非常容易安装和部署。...它也有完整管理支持来维护和管理您订单。您将获得完整源代码、前端和后端。它具有多供应商支持。该脚本具有商店版本深色模式和浅色模式,这将震撼您用户体验。...功能 店面特色: 完整认证 快速添加到购物车 异步全文搜索 基于类别的项目过滤 支持 Omnipay [ Stripe ] 用户帐户设置 我订单 基于 React、Next 和 Tailwind 支持下一个...SEO 搜索引擎优化友好 管理功能: 分析仪表板 管理产品 管理类别 管理产品类型 管理订单 管理订单状态 管理客户 管理税收 商店设置 使用 React、Next 和 Tailwind 构建 下载&

8410

shopping Test method

2.功能测试 登录时: 将商品加入购物车,页面跳转到登录页面,登录成功后购物车数量增加; 点击购物车菜单,页面跳转到登录页面。...登录后: 所有链接是否跳转正确; 商品是否可以成功加入购物车; .购物车商品总数是否有限制; .商品总数是否正确; 全选功能是否好用; .删除功能是否好用; 填写委托单功能是否好用; 委托单填写价格是否正确显示...; 价格总计是否正确; 商品文字太长时是否显示完整; 店铺名字太长时是否显示完整; 创新券商品是否打标; 购物车中下架商品是否有特殊标识; 新加入购物车商品排序(添加购物车存在店铺商品和购物车不存在店铺商品...4.易用性测试 删除功能是否有提示;是否有回到顶部功能;商品过多时结算按钮是否可以浮动显示购物车目的 任何产品功能都有目的,App端购物车就好比我们在超市手推车购物车。...目前平台采用是下单扣减库存 购物车和商品系统、库存系统、活动系统、订单系统,我们金融电商,还和风控系统交互,算属于一个比较复杂模块了,在此次产品设计,得到了挺多锻炼。

90310

Shofy v1.0.10 – 在线B2B电子商务和多供应商市场 Laravel 平台

简介 Shofy – 一个用于电子商务多功能 Laravel 系统,是一个时尚且现代 HTML5、Bootstrap 驱动电子商务解决方案,配备了全面的功能。...这个基于 Laravel 电子商务系统是一个强大工具,用于创建专业且具有视觉吸引力在线商店。精心设计脚本有助于快速、轻松地构建电子商务网站,该网站不仅具有吸引人外观,而且还可以无缝运行。...这些主题为您在线商店提供了基本结构和布局,包括专用于产品列表、购物车、结账流程等页面。...无论您是要启动电子商务事业还是寻求增强现有网站,Laravel 电子商务脚本都是宝贵资产,可以根据您独特需求开发高质量在线商店。 Shofy 是高度可定制——在平板电脑和移动设备上看起来很棒。...PHP_CURL 模块启用 演示&下载 主页:https://shofy.botble.com 管理面板:https://shofy.botble.com/admin 管理员帐户:admin – 12345678(用户名和密码自动填充

12310

电商网站分析实践(

第二部分:从产品放入购物车到订单达成 用户已选择好了产品并放入到购物车,这时我们任务就是保证用户购买支付流程可以尽量流畅,使得尽量多用户可以到达订单达成页面。...为什么有些用户从转化漏斗离开,为什么有些用户删除了购物车产品,或为什么有些用户在他们原来购物列表增加了更多产品,如能从数据找出这些问题答案,就可以有针对性地对购物流程做出更好优化。...4、购物车商品删除动作 我们会监控有多少商品被放入了购物车,同样,我们也要监控在购买完成之前有多少商品被用户购物车删除掉。...除了这个原因外,也有可能是因为产品引导或推荐机制存在问题,不同问题需要使用不同优化解决方案。 5、优惠券和促销代码 在购物车页面是否应该显示促销代码输入框,在电商行业仍存在较大分歧。...在购物车页面上显示促销代码输入框是否会对网站销售产生负面的影响,最好还是通过数据去进行验证。我们可以思考和验证以下问题:如果购物车页面上没有促销代码输入框,用户放弃率是否会有明显变动?

1.6K41

woocommerce shortcode短代码调用

woocommerce_cart – 显示购物车页面  woocommerce_checkout – 显示结帐页面  woocommerce_my_account – 显示用户帐户页面 woocommerce_order_tracking...ids– 将根据逗号分隔帖子 ID 列表显示产品。 skus– 将根据逗号分隔 SKU 列表显示产品。 如果商品显示,请确保未在“目录可见性”中将其设置为“隐藏”。...limit="12"] ---- 加入购物车 按ID显示单个产品价格并添加到购物车按钮。...: [add_to_cart id="99"] ---- 添加到购物车网址 按 ID 在单个产品添加到购物车按钮上显示 URL。...---- woocommerce短代码常见问题  变体产品 SKU 显示 关于 SKU 短代码使用,例如,变体产品 SKU 不打算单独显示,而不是父变量产品 SKU。

10.8K20

最受推荐 9本全栈开发书籍,助web前端开发学习

Spring Boot开发 将WebSockets、WebServices和push notification作为通信层 创建一个良好用户界面 基于地图用户界面 通过短信/社交网络进行用户授权...本书首先对Vue.js及其核心概念进行了全面的介绍,并对每个概念进行了解释,然后再在项目中实践;然后,你将使用Laravel构建一个web服务,并将前端集成到一个完整堆栈应用程序。...8、《Learn Full-Stack JavaScript Development》 本书将和你一起开发一个小型电子商务应用程序,用户可以在这个程序里浏览产品,将其添加到购物车,你还将创建一个完整后端...,管理员可以通过它创建、修改和删除产品。...一个好Web前端工程师他能够很好理解产品经理对用户体验要求,也能够很好地理解后台工程师对数据逻辑。或者程序逻辑进行分离要求,并将这些要求转化成前台开发工作。

3.9K10

微服务与SOA实践

直接比较 - 建立购物车 让我们看看一个在线购物网站。这个网站有几个不同功能 —— 产品目录,用户帐户和购物车等等。...在该应用程序,代码可用于执行诸如显示项目,添加和删除购物车物品,查看库存,处理运输选项,处理税务计算,处理账单,更改显示内容,以及将最终订单详细信息发送给用户(除其他事项外)。...其中一个场景:用于在购物车显示产品代码在购物车应用程序内,可能与用于在浏览目录视图内显示产品项目的代码完全不同,导致需要两组类似但不同代码来维护,并且可能还有一些更大应用程序用户体验不一致。...购物车功能还可以使用在购物应用程序内多个场景使用一些常用服务,诸如显示项目服务,显示产品图像服务,支票库存服务,用户支付偏好服务和电子邮件服务 —— 在那里在“购物车”与“产品目录”与“用户帐户”之间没有界限...在这种情况下,将SOA与购物车用户帐户和产品展示组件集成到网站其他部分可能比使用上面定义具有更多粒度组件微服务体系结构更有意义。

93970

2019年最接地气一套PHP面试题(附答案)

高并发情况下,将用户进入排队队列,用一个线程循环处理从排队队列取出一个用户,判断用户是否已在抢购结果队列,如果在,则已抢购,否则抢购,库存减1,写数据库,将用户入结果队列。...用户可以在购物网站不同页面之间跳转,以选购自己喜爱商品,点击购买时,该商品就自动保存到你购物车,重复选购后,最后将选中所有商品放在购物车中统一到付款台结账,这也是尽量让客户体验到现实生活购物感觉...主要涉及以下几点: 1、把商品添加到购物车,即订购 2、删除购物车已定购商品 3、修改购物车某一本图书订购数量 4、清空购物车 5、显示购物车商品清单及数量...答:判断用户有没有登录,在没有登录情况下,不允许下单。登陆后,可进行下单,并生成唯一订单号,此时订单状态为支付。 26.电商登录是怎么实现?...(访问令牌),通过这个access_token,我们可以调用QQ提供给我们接口,比如获取open_id,可以获取用户基本信息。

59730

2019年最新PHP面试题

高并发情况下,将用户进入排队队列,用一个线程循环处理从排队队列取出一个用户,判断用户是否已在抢购结果队列,如果在,则已抢购,否则抢购,库存减1,写数据库,将用户入结果队列。 22.购物车原理?...用户可以在购物网站不同页面之间跳转,以选购自己喜爱商品,点击购买时,该商品就自动保存到你购物车,重复选购后,最后将选中所有商品放在购物车中统一到付款台结账,这也是尽量让客户体验到现实生活购物感觉...主要涉及以下几点:     1、把商品添加到购物车,即订购     2、删除购物车已定购商品     3、修改购物车某一本图书订购数量     4、清空购物车     5、显示购物车商品清单及数量...答:判断用户有没有登录,在没有登录情况下,不允许下单。登陆后,可进行下单,并生成唯一订单号,此时订单状态为支付。 26.电商登录是怎么实现?...(访问令牌),通过这个access_token,我们可以调用QQ提供给我们接口,比如获取open_id,可以获取用户基本信息。

59360

Java项目实践,订单管理与购物车实现思路

2、购物车 购物车登录情况下,因为没有用户信息,所以这时候如果想要存储购物车信息,只能保存在浏览器客户端。...登录以后,购物车一般存储在数据库或者缓存,之前接触过一个B2B电商,因为他金额数量较大,交易周期比较长,购物车信息可能会存放很久,这种情况下,还是保存在数据库中比较安全;(主键、用户id、商品...第二个参数field,我们存储“产品id”,第三个参数存储“产品数量”;当给购物车存放一个商品或者取出一个商品时,通过用户id和产品id,可以直接获取购物车商品数量,然后进行加减操作,在进行覆盖操作就可以...另外,由于用户登录时,购物车信息只能保存在客户端,不能和用户建立联系,所以如果有其他人借用电脑,购物车信息就可能混乱,这个是不可避免,如果要考虑这点,最好方式,就是用户不登录时,不让他操作购物车。...还有就是,如果登录时,保存了购物车信息,在登录成功后,一定要把购物车信息同步给登录用户

3K20

Laravel Sanctum API 授权

Sanctum 允许应用程序每个用户为他们帐户生成多个 API 令牌。这些令牌可以被授予指定允许令牌执行哪些操作能力 / 范围。...api 中间件组: 'api' => [ \Laravel\Sanctum\Http\Middleware\EnsureFrontendRequestsAreStateful::class,...9默认是注释掉,需要取消注释 API 令牌认证 发布 API Tokens 要开始为用户颁发令牌,你 User 模型应使用 Laravel\Sanctum\HasApiTokens trait...创建令牌后,你应该立即向用户显示此值: $token = $request->user()->createToken($request->token_name); return ['token' =>...修改 sanctum 配置文件 expiration 选项(默认为 null),此选项设置数字表示多少分钟后过期: // 365天后过期 'expiration' => 525600, 如果您程序配置了

2.9K30

Salesforce Commerce Cloud简介

(Tip:Commerce Cloud是绿色圆圈购物车那个) ?...他们可以高亮显示购物者找不到商品位置,提供同一商品在不同店铺位置, 并可以在商店任何地方完成交易。 ? Commerce Cloud是如何做到?...3.Commerce Cloud Einstein Commerce Cloud Einstein作为Salesforce Einstein一部分,在Commerce Cloud整个结构中提供内置在产品智能能力...通过产品推荐,品牌可以自动显示购物者下一次最有可能购买产品产品推荐对于每个用户都是唯一,可通过网页,手机或实体店销售人员亲自提供给客户。...通过Predictive Sort,电子商务网站上每个搜索或类别页面上显示产品订单可以自动为购物者进行个性化展示,让购物者最相关产品将首先显示在网页上。

2.6K10

购物车需求分析与解决方案

当下已经被引申为产品统一编号简称,每种产品均对应有唯一SKU号。 针对电商而言,SKU有另外注解: 1、SKU是指一款商品,每款都有出现一个SKU,便于电商品牌识别商品。...1.2实现思路 购物车数据存储结构如下: 京东实现思路: 当用户登录情况下,将此购物车存入cookies , 在用户登陆情况下,将购物车数据存入redis 。...如果用户登陆时,cookies存在购物车,需要将cookies购物车合并到redis存储,清空cookies购物车。...ID //3.根据商家ID判断购物车列表是否存在该商家购物车 //4.如果购物车列表不存在该商家购物车 //4.1...新建购物车对象 //4.2 将新建购物车对象添加到购物车列表 //5.如果购物车列表存在该商家购物车 // 查询购物车明细列表是否存在该商品

87920

如何在PHP中使用数组

1、PHP如何获取数组里元素个数实例 在 PHP ,使用 count()函数对数组元素个数进行统计。 例如,使用 count()函数统计数组元素个数,示例代码如下: <?..."), "js"= array("vue","react") ); echo count($arr,true); 输出结果为: 7 注意:在统计二维数组时,如果直接使用 count()函数只会显示到一维数组个数...说明:array_search()函数最常见应用是购物车,实现对购物车中指定商品数量修改和删除! 3、PHP一维数组与二维数组相互转换示例 一维数组转换二维数组示例代码: <?...list()函数和 each()函数综合应用,获取储存在组数用户登录信息。...首先创建用户登录表单,用于实现用户登录信息录入,然后使用 each()函数提取全局数组$_POST内容,最后使用 white 语句循环输出用户所提交注重信息。 示例代码如下: <!

11.2K10

推荐17-Laravel 中使用 JWT 认证 Restful API

说明 我们先写下我们应用程序详细信息和功能。我们将使用 JWT 身份验证在 laravel 中使用 restful API 构建基本用户产品列表。...A User 将会使用以下功能 注册并创建一个新帐户 登录到他们帐户 注销和丢弃 token 并离开应用程序 获取登录用户详细信息 检索可供用户使用产品列表 按ID查找特定产品 将新产品添加到用户产品列表...如果用户认证,这个中间件会抛出 UnauthorizedHttpException 异常。 设置路由 开始之前,我们将为所有本教程讨论点设置路由。...index , 为经过身份认证用户获取所有产品列表 show , 根据 ID 获取特定产品 store , 将新产品存储到产品列表 update , 根据 ID 更新产品详情 destroy ,...根据 ID 从列表删除产品 添加一个构造函数来获取经过身份认证用户,并将其保存在 user 属性

10.9K20

学习猿地 python教程 django教程4 项目结构设计

1.业务流程     首页-->列表-->详情-->购物车-->下单-->支付 2.项目的基本结构:     前台 会员使用,浏览         会员: 登录,注册,个人中心(个人信息,我订单,收藏...首页: 显示分类列表,显示推荐,热门产品,广告...         列表: 搜索,列表,排行...         详情: 产品信息,相关产品信息,...        ...购物车: 添加,删除,更新,查询..        ...,编辑推荐,内容简介,作者简介,目录,媒体评论,试读章节 图书图库模型         id,图片url,图书ID 购物车模型     id, 会员id,产品id,数量, 订单模型:     id,...    会员ID,     收货地址ID     订单状态, 0 支付,1已支付,2取消,3退款..

43330
领券